Vulcan Energy has signed a binding offtake agreement with Glencore for 36,000–44,000 tonnes of lithium hydroxide over eight years from its planned Phase One project in Germany. The deal is conditional on Vulcan securing project financing, completing construction, and producing battery-grade lithium, with delivery expected post-2028. This agreement secures about 20% of Vulcan’s projected output and strengthens its financing case, but actual production is still years away as the company has no operating facility yet.

Why offtake after the DFS makes strategic sense: -Post-DFS = lower risk for buyers
A DFS will validate:
Capex/Opex, Product quality (pilot-scale testing), Engineering viability, Timeline estimates
That’s the point where a Tier 1 OEM or trader can: Lock in a supply position, Help with project financing, Possibly negotiate convertible debt, equity, or prepayment terms.
